Abstract

This paper concerns with the correlation of phase equilibrium of binary system of carbon dioxide-ethanol at subcritical and supercritical condition. In this study, three equations of state

(Redlich-Kwong, Soave-Redlich-Kwong, and Peng-Robinson) together with conventional mixing rule, were applied for correlating phase equilibrium the system. The capabilities of these equations of state were examined with experiment results obtained from the literatures. The results show that Soave-Redlich-Kwong and Peng-Robinsoh equations of states can well correlate the phase equilibrium of binary system of carbon dioxide-ethanol.
